Ringing off, I put my phone back in my bag and concentrated on driving. It was about five minutes into the drive that I realised a small hold up building up in front of me. There were no cars far ahead as I could see, so what was happening? After spending about two minutes of following the queue slowly, I got to the point of the hold up and saw this car parked in the middle of the road! The driver still had his engine running, but showed no signs of moving. There was a large gap between him and the curb where he would have parked if he was in his correct senses. “Oga, can’t you park well? You are in the middle of the road for goodness sake,”I called out. He first of all ignored me, then later with a frown gestured with his arm that I should move on.
